Cinnamon essential oil is spicy and warming and used in very small amounts in cosmetics for its antiseptic properties. This oil’s energising and stimulating aroma makes it ideal for lifting spirits. It was used by the ancient Egyptians as an aromatic foot massage.

Latin name: | Cinnamomum zeylanicum |
---|---|
Country of origin: | Sri Lanka |
Scent group: | Spicy |
Method of extraction: | Steam distilled |
Balances emotions
An uplifting room scent, the oil can help to counter exhaustion and depression.
Soothes aches and pains
Cinnamon essential oil is warming if you feel particularly chilly, as it helps to boost circulation to the extremities. It’s especially effective for reviving and soothing sore joints aggravated by cold, damp weather.
Acts as an antiseptic
Cinnamon essential oil is effective against a broad range of bacteria, viruses, and parasites, especially lice and scabies.
Relatively nontoxic. Its major component, eugenol, causes irritation to mucous membranes: use in moderation and very well diluted (less than 0.5 per cent). Use only cinnamon leaf essential oil on the skin (not cinnamon bark).
